According to Glassdoor, the average salary for a Navy SEAL is $53,450.SEAL Teams. NSW has eight Navy SEAL Teams. The odd-numbered Teams (1, 3, 5 and 7) work for Group ONE in Coronado, CA, and 2, 4, 8, and 10 for Group TWO in Little Creek, VA. A SEAL Team is commanded by a Navy Commander (O-5) and is composed of a HQS element and eight operational 16-man SEAL Platoons.EMGDF: Get the latest Navy Resources stock price and detailed information including EMGDF news, historical charts and realtime prices. A Glance at the Origins of Naval Special Warfare. The evolutionary history of SEALs began during World War II at Amphibious Training Base (ATB), Little Creek, Virginia, in late August 1942, with two special-mission units, Amphibious Scouts and Raiders (S&R) (Joint) and Special Mission Demolition Unit.
